Navigating the Future: Innovations in Banking Software Development 

The banking sector is embracing technological advancements, with software development enhancing customer experiences, streamlining operations, and ensuring financial transaction security.

In an era where technological advancements are reshaping industries, the banking sector stands at the forefront of innovation. The development of banking software has become pivotal in enhancing customer experiences, streamlining operations, and ensuring security in financial transactions. Let's delve into the key innovations driving the evolution of banking software development. 

Artificial Intelligence Integration: 

AI-powered chatbots: Chatbots equipped with natural language processing capabilities provide round-the-clock customer support, assisting with inquiries, account management, and even financial advice. 

Predictive analytics: AI algorithms analyze customer data to anticipate their needs and preferences, enabling personalized recommendations and tailored financial solutions. 

Fraud detection: Advanced AI algorithms detect suspicious patterns and anomalies in transactions, bolstering security measures and minimizing the risk of fraudulent activities. 

Blockchain Technology: 

Enhanced security: Blockchain ensures the immutability and transparency of transaction records, reducing the risk of data tampering and unauthorized access. 

Smart contracts: Automated execution of predefined contract terms based on predefined conditions streamlines processes such as loan approvals, settlements, and compliance procedures. 

Cross-border transactions: Blockchain facilitates faster and more cost-effective cross-border payments by eliminating intermediaries and reducing transactional complexities. 

Digital Wallets and Payment Solutions: 

Contactless payments: Mobile wallets and NFC-enabled devices enable seamless and secure contactless transactions, catering to the growing demand for convenient payment methods. 

Peer-to-peer payments: Banking software facilitates instant fund transfers between individuals, eliminating the need for traditional payment intermediaries. 

Tokenization: Token-based authentication enhances the security of digital transactions by replacing sensitive card details with unique tokens, mitigating the risk of data breaches. 

Cloud Computing Adoption: 

Scalability and flexibility: Cloud-based banking solutions offer scalability to accommodate fluctuating workloads and enable rapid deployment of new features and updates. 

Cost efficiency: By eliminating the need for on-premises infrastructure and maintenance, cloud computing reduces operational costs while ensuring high availability and disaster recovery capabilities. 

Data analytics: Cloud platforms provide robust data analytics tools that enable banks to derive actionable insights from vast amounts of customer data, driving informed decision-making and personalized services. 

Open Banking Initiatives: 

API-driven ecosystem: Open banking frameworks allow banks to securely share customer data with third-party developers via APIs, fostering collaboration and innovation in financial services. 

Personal finance management: Banking software integrates with third-party apps to offer comprehensive personal finance management tools, empowering customers to budget, track expenses, and optimize savings. 

Marketplace banking: Open banking platforms facilitate the integration of various financial products and services from multiple providers, offering customers a one-stop-shop for their banking needs. 

Cybersecurity Measures: 

Biometric authentication: Banking software leverages biometric authentication methods such as fingerprint recognition, facial recognition, and voice authentication to enhance security and prevent unauthorized access. 

Behavioral analytics: Advanced algorithms analyze user behavior patterns to identify anomalies and potential security threats, enabling proactive risk mitigation measures. 

Continuous monitoring: Real-time monitoring and threat intelligence systems provide banks with enhanced visibility into cyber threats, allowing for immediate response and remediation actions. 

Regulatory Compliance Solutions: 

Automated compliance checks: Banking software automates compliance processes by integrating regulatory guidelines and conducting real-time checks on transactions, ensuring adherence to anti-money laundering (AML) and Know Your Customer (KYC) regulations. 

Regulatory reporting: Automated reporting tools generate accurate and timely regulatory reports, reducing manual efforts and mitigating the risk of non-compliance penalties. 

Audit trails: Comprehensive audit trails track every transaction and user interaction within the banking system, ensuring transparency and accountability in regulatory compliance efforts. 

Conclusion: 

The landscape of banking software development is constantly evolving, driven by technological innovation, changing customer expectations, and regulatory requirements. By embracing advancements such as artificial intelligence, blockchain technology, and open banking initiatives, banks can stay ahead of the curve and deliver seamless, secure, and personalized financial services to their customers. As we navigate the future of banking, collaboration between banks, fintechs, and regulatory bodies will be essential in shaping the next generation of banking software solutions. 

 


Chloe Wilson

3 Blog posts

Comments